[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: sortering av e-mail (procmail ?)



Karl Hasselstrom wrote:

On 2003-05-05 12:54:55 +0200, Torbjörn Svensson wrote:
Karl Hasselstrom wrote:
Såvitt jag har förstått kan detta göras alldeles utmärkt med
Sieve.
Japp, det verkar funka med Sieve, kollade på cyrus info sida om
Sieve med, dock hittade jag inget om var man ska lägga scripten.
Använder du det möjligtvis ?

Om jag kommer ihåg rätt så finns det ett kommando som laddar upp ditt
sieveskript till cyrus-servern. Kolla med "dpkg -L <lämpligt
cyrus-paket>" vilka program cyrus levereras med, och läs man-sidorna.

Hela tanken med sieveskripten är att de ska köras på servern, även om
denna server betjänar flera hundra personer. Därför är språket byggt
så att inte ens klåfingriga och/eller illvilliga användare ska kunna
sänka servern, t.ex. genom att anropa externa program som äter upp all
CPU-tid och allt minne.

(Nepp, jag har aldrig kört Cyrus.)

Hej igen!
Har nu fått upp en cyrus med sieve, ett problem kvarstår dock, skriva scripten.
Hittar ingen info om hur syntaxen behandlas. tex.

if header :contains :all [ "to", "cc", "bcc"] "debian-user-swedish@lists.debian.org" {
       fileinto "INBOX.debian";
}

Hur behandlas detta ? Blir det enbart true om _alla_ fält innehåller debian-user-swedish@lists.debian.org eller funkar det om endast 1 fält innehåller det ? iom att vissa skickar cc till deb..@l.d.o så måste den kunna matcha på flera.
iofs skulle man kunna ha flera regler om detta. men vill vara effektiv.

Skulle även vara taksam för bra tutor / howto's inom sieve.

MVH Tobbe



Reply to: